To run the code I describe below I am calling the julia terminal as: $ julia -p 4 I am following the documentation here: http://docs.julialang.org/en/latest/manual/parallel-computing/ For one example, specifically, I am facing some problems. In this section: http://docs.julialang.org/en/latest/manual/parallel-computing/#id2 I am trying to run the following piece of code: @everywhere advection_shared_chunk!(q, u) = advection_chunk!(q, u, myrange(q)..., 1:size(q,3)-1) function advection_shared!(q, u) @sync begin for p in procs(q) @async remotecall_wait(advection_shared_chunk!, p, q, u) end end q end q = SharedArray(Float64, (500,500,500)) u = SharedArray(Float64, (500,500,500)) #Run once to JIT-compile advection_shared!(q,u) But I am facing the following error: ERROR: MethodError: `remotecall_wait` has no method matching remotecall_wait(::Function, ::Int64, ::SharedArray{Float64,3}, ::SharedArray{Float64,3}) Closest candidates are: remotecall_wait(::LocalProcess, ::Any, ::Any...) remotecall_wait(::Base.Worker, ::Any, ::Any...) remotecall_wait(::Integer, ::Any, ::Any...) in anonymous at task.jl:447 ...and 3 other exceptions. in sync_end at ./task.jl:413 [inlined code] from task.jl:422 in advection_shared! at none:2 What am I doing wrong here?
